#18d99e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18d99e is composed of 9.4% red, 85.1%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 27.2%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 161.7 degrees, a saturation of 80.1% and a lightness of 47.3%. #18d99e color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#00b33d.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

Shades and Tints of #18d99e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010504 is the darkest color, while #f2fef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#18d99e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757c7a is the less saturated color, while #05eca5 is the most saturated one.
